A stretch of rail cars along 12th Street that decoupled on Saturday afternoon has closed east and westbound traffic at Mill Street SE, State Street and Chemeketa Street NE, according to Salem Police.
It was not immediately clear what caused the rail cars to decouple.
Impacted roads will be closed for an undetermined length of time, police said.
Police are asking drivers to find alternative routes.
